How Towing Uniforms Enhance Safety on the Road

High Visibility for Roadside Safety

One of the most important aspects of towing uniforms is visibility. Tow truck operators frequently work on busy roads and highways, often in low-light or hazardous conditions. High-visibility uniforms with reflective strips help ensure that passing drivers can see them from a distance, reducing the risk of accidents.

Protection from the Elements

Towing professionals work in various weather conditions, from scorching summer heat to freezing winter storms. High-quality towing uniforms protect against harsh elements, helping operators stay comfortable and focused. 

Breathable, moisture-wicking fabrics keep them cool in hot weather, while insulated jackets and waterproof gear provide warmth and protection in colder climates.

Durability and Safety Features

Towing work is physically demanding, requiring durable clothing that can withstand the rigors of the job. Reinforced stitching, heavy-duty fabrics, and flame-resistant materials add an extra layer of safety for workers exposed to hazardous conditions. 

Uniforms with built-in knee padding, sturdy pockets, and tear-resistant fabrics further enhance functionality and protection.

Key Features to Look for in Towing Uniforms

When selecting towing uniforms for your team, consider the following essential features:

High-Visibility Elements

Look for uniforms with reflective stripes and bright colors to enhance visibility, especially for night-time or roadside operations.

Durable and Weather-Resistant Fabric

Opt for sturdy materials that can withstand harsh conditions, frequent washing, and long working hours.

Functional Design

Uniforms should have ample pockets, reinforced seams, and protective elements like knee pads and moisture-resistant fabrics.

Comfortable Fit

Employees work long shifts, so uniforms should be breathable and comfortable, allowing for easy movement.

Custom Branding

Adding logos, company names, and employee identification enhances brand recognition and customer trust.
